6f4b384e79 configure: avoid non-POSIX: local var=...
The vast majority of shells do support "local", but not all, notably
AT&T ksh (default sh in illumos-based distros and Solaris), but also
some other POSIX-compliant shells, so remove "local".

print_str(), print_num() are modified trivially.

default() now uses standard "Assign Default Value" - same semantics,
and works in all shells (and POSIX).

default_conf() is identical to before, but it had and still has few
minor issues, which will be addressed in a future commit.

05ebe494dd configure: avoid non-POSIX: test ... -a/-o ...
Shells do support those, and typically simple forms do work, but
these were removed in POSIX 2024 because they are notoriously hard
to parse correctly, and shells don't always agree on the result.

Instead, use standard forms which all shells support identically.

Extreme high level overview of quotes in POSIX shell:
- WORDs without $... or glob don't need quotes (echo, =, no, x86, ...).
- a=  b=foo  c=$...  and  case $d in ...  all don't need quotes.
- IFS/glob affect command and arguments (not assignments or case..in):
  - IFS only splits direct result of $..., quotes will prevent that.
  - Glob then splits/matches *?[]      and quotes will prevent that.

cea857bf73 configure: win32: don't fail when building using tcc
Commit 729918e ("make: make shorter command lines", 2024-11-21) added
"-static" when $cc_name is gcc to statically link with the mingw gcc
runtime, so that tcc.exe won't depend on additional non-system dlls.

However, $cc_name is still the default value at this time - gcc,
so "-static" was unconditional, and it failed if $cc is tcc (msvcrt).

This commit instead checks the already known $cc, and restores the
ability to build tcc using tcc (if "$cc" doesn't contain "gcc").

b671fc0594 LIBTCCAPI tcc_relocate(s) : REMOVED 2nd argument
removed second argument for tcc_relocate(s). previous
'TCC_RELOCATE_AUTO' is now default and only behavior.

Rationale:
  In the past, the option to compile into memory provided by the
  user was introduced because only one TCCState could exist at a time.

  This is no longer a limitation.  As such it is also possible now to
  keep any number of compiled code snippets around together with their
  state in order to run them as needed.

6b967b1285 Fix macOS .dylib build when VERSION contains letters.
macOS builds with --disable-static fail to link if the version number
contains letters because of the -current_version and
-compatibility_version arguments (current version is 0.9.28rc).

This commit adds a new MACOS_DYLIB_VERSION variable to config.mak for
builds that target macOS. It has no impact on other targets.

ca11849ebb Permit '=' character in configure options
By replacing the `-f 2` field selection with `-f 2-`, we select fields
2 and beyond, so that arguments containing the '=' character are not
truncated.

This option qualifier list format is POSIX standard and tested
to work with the `cut` program from:
* GNU coreutils
* macOS (FreeBSD)
* NetBSD
* toybox
* busybox
* uutils-coreutils

In my case, this is useful because I'm trying to use an installation
prefix which contains an equals sign.
